Leica MDa

Leica MDa with body cap.
The MD was replaced by the MDa. Features remained basically the same, the MDa was based on the
M4 frame,
with its slant mounted rewind with folding crank. As with the MD, Post versions were manufactured for
Post
Office meter recording of telephone meters, available in 24x36 and 24x27 image sizes.

Production figures by year and image size (Post):
Year | MDA | Post 24x36 | Post 24x27 | Motor |
1966 | 1800 | -0- | -0- | -0- |
1967 | -0- | 75 | -0- | -0- |
1968 | 1736 | -0- | 10 | -0- |
1969 | 1200 | 50 | 20 | -0- |
1970 | 1350 | -0- | -0- | -0- |
1971 | 2100 | 75 | 4 | -0- |
1972 | 672 | -0- | 183 | 200 |
1973 | 1500 | -0- | -0- | -0- |
1974 | 1000 | -0- | -0- | -0- |
1975 | 400 | -0- | -0- | -0- |
1976 | 2550 | -0- | -0- | -0- |
Total | 14308 | 200 | 217 | 200 |
